The Appeal of a 98% RTP
A key feature that sets this game apart is its exceptionally high Return to Player (RTP) of 98%. In the context of online gaming, RTP refers to the percentage of all wagered money that is paid back to players over time. A 98% RTP means that, on average, players can expect to receive $98 back for every $100 wagered. This is significantly higher than many other casual games and makes chicken road demo an incredibly attractive option for players seeking fair and rewarding gameplay. The high RTP rate does not guarantee a win on every play, rather it describes a mathematical probability over the long run.
